BJP blocks MGNREGA and Awas Yojana fund but now spending money on "misleading" advertisements: Mamata

Gopiballavpur/Daspur (WB), May 17 (UNI), West Bengal Chief Minister Mamata Banerjee alleged on Friday that the BJP is now spending money on "misleading" advertisements.
Addressing the election rally, Banerjee said, "In advertisements everywhere, the PM is claiming to give free electricity and cooking gas, but people have not gotten anything. Do not trust 420 Babus, as whatever they print in newspapers is using money."
"The BJP blocked the MGNREGA dues of 59 lakh workers and the funds for houses of Awas Yojana beneficiaries, but is using money to give advertisements and spread their propaganda," she said.
"I condemn those who are allowing misleading advertisements, presented as statements,
without including the name of the publisher. Today, there were a few photos of people.
thanking PM Modi and the Home Minister for CAA. "
"The entire thing is a lie orchestrated by the BJP, just as they did in Sandeshkhali. I urge my Matua brothers and sisters to not fall for it. The moment anyone applies under CAA, they will be dismissed as foreigners," she added.
"The entire thing is a lie, but seeing the advertisement, people might question if it is the truth. Let me tell you, it is not the truth but a falsehood and only a part of the politics before the elections. After
When the polls are over, people will be expelled from their homes and put in jails. Do not trust.
Modi or his people. They are 420, and their words have no guarantee," she stated.
"The BJP claims that they are giving free rations, but it is a lie. For the past two years, it has been the state government that has been bearing the costs and providing free food grains to people. Their claims are 420, and there is no guarantee. They have also been claiming that they are ensuring water supply, but In reality, we are providing over 70% of the resources for the water supply scheme.
"We have cleared the dues for the MGNREGA workers who were made to wait for two years by the BJP government. The state government has come up with the Karmashree scheme, under which
Job cardholders will be given 50 days of work, which can be extended up to 60 days. "
"By December, our state government will clear the first installment of houses for 11 lakh Awas.
Yojana beneficiaries, who were denied a roof over their heads by the BJP.,
"The BJP is desperate to secure a win. If they win, they will impose NRC-UCC, which will erase the
identities of our diverse communities. If Modi wins, he will not allow elections anymore."
"When the India Bloc comes to power, we will abolish CAA-NRC-UCC. I have no relations with them in Bengal, but I am associated with them when it comes to the national level. When the India Bloc forms the government, we will also hear out the demands of the Sari and Sarna groups," she stated.
